body{background:#886c90}.login{position:fixed;height:100%;width:100%;overflow:auto;text-align:center;background:url(/classes/template/layout/page-login/img/fundo.png) no-repeat center center;background-size:cover;color:#05264c}.login .login__block{max-width:400px;width:100%;text-align:center;box-shadow:0 0 17px rgba(0,0,0,.2705882353);margin-top:120px;display:none;background:rgba(227,227,227,.6);border-radius:25px;position:relative}.login .login__block.visible{z-index:10;display:inline-block}.login .login__block .login__header{height:110px;display:flex;flex-direction:column;justify-content:center;position:relative;background:#00264d;width:110px;margin:-54px auto 0;border-radius:50%}.login .login__block .login__header img{width:59px;height:59px;margin:4px auto}.login .login__block .login-footer{background:linear-gradient(180deg, rgba(0, 0, 0, 0.1) 0%, rgba(39, 39, 39, 0.2) 7.42%, rgba(88, 88, 88, 0.4) 18.13%, rgba(131, 131, 131, 0.6) 29.11%, rgba(166, 166, 166, 0.6) 40.18%, rgba(227, 227, 227, 0.6) 86%);margin-bottom:-49px;left:50px;right:50px;border-radius:0 0 25px 25px;position:absolute;padding:14px}.login .login__block .login-footer .login__helper{color:#fff;font-size:15px;text-transform:uppercase}.login .login__body{padding:28px}.login .login__body .form-control{position:relative}.login .login__body .form-control:focus{z-index:1}.login .login__body .form-group{background:rgba(0,38,77,.6);display:flex}.login .login__body .form-group input{padding:12px}.login .login__body .form-group #email,.login .login__body .form-group #password,.login .login__body .form-group #recuperar-email{border-radius:0;border:none;outline:none;color:#fff}.login .login__body .form-group #email::placeholder,.login .login__body .form-group #password::placeholder,.login .login__body .form-group #recuperar-email::placeholder{color:rgba(255,255,255,.6)}.login .login__body .form-group .icon{background:#00264d;min-width:47px;display:flex;align-items:center;justify-content:center}.login .login__body .form-group .icon img{height:21px}.login .select-lang-icones{display:flex;padding:0 8px}.login .select-lang-icones a,.login .select-lang-icones span{padding:4px 2px;width:100%;transition:all .1s}.login .select-lang-icones a img,.login .select-lang-icones span img{width:100%}.login .select-lang-icones a.active,.login .select-lang-icones span.active{display:none}.login .select-lang-icones a:hover,.login .select-lang-icones span:hover{background:#1f2a31;width:130%;margin-top:-5px}.login .login__btn{padding:.65rem 42px;min-width:175px;border-radius:25px;display:inline-block;font-size:15.5px;margin:28px auto 0;transition:all .3s;border:none;background:#00264d;color:#fff}.login .login__btn :hover{background-color:#1e2a31;color:#e8e8e8}/*# sourceMappingURL=style.css.map */
